    Actually I understood what the problem was.

    I was looking for the Default Response because I wanted to be sure that the request sent by the Zigbee Coordinator was actually executed by the device.

    I will briefly explain my way to obtain the parsing of the Default Response by the Zigbee Coordinator:

    After sending the write attribute request through a specific command by the Coordinator to the Router, the Router executes the command and sends the Default Response back to the Zigbee Coordinator.

    To read the Default Response, I have to register the callback to handle the ZCL commands

    ZB_AF_SET_ENDPOINT_HANDLER(HA_WINDOW_CONTROLLER_ENDPOINT, zcl_device_cb

    When it arrives, I do this:

    zb_zcl_write_attr_res_t * p_attr_resp;
    zb_uint8_t status_resp = 0;
    
    static zb_void_t zcl_device_cb(zb_uint8_t param)
    {
        zb_buf_t                       * p_buffer = ZB_BUF_FROM_REF(param);
        zb_zcl_parsed_hdr_t * p_cmd_info = ZB_GET_BUF_PARAM(p_buffer, zb_zcl_parsed_hdr_t);
    
        ZB_ZCL_GET_NEXT_WRITE_ATTR_RES(p_buffer, p_attr_resp);
    
        status_resp = p_attr_resp->status;
    }

    Are you only looking for the MAC acknowledge?

    If you want to make sure that the value have changed, you should configure the reporting so that the device is notified about changes to the value. You  can use a simple read attribute command to read the value of the attribute.
